Bangladesh cricketer Tamim back home after heart attack

March 28, 2025

Tamim Iqbal was admitted to hospital on Monday after suffering chest pains while competing in a match in Bangladesh. Former Bangladeshi cricket captain Tamim Iqbal has returned home from hospital, days after suffering a massive heart attack during a local match. The 36-year-old was released on Friday.
